Calgary Bylaws and Pool Permit Process

Understanding the city zoning laws is non-negotiable for any above-ground pool installation. In most cases, pools over 24 inches in height or holding more than 4,000 liters require a permit. Working with a certified pool technician ensures your pool safety fencing meets all municipal requirements from day one.

  • Secure your compliance form before groundbreaking
  • Set up child-proof barriers that are at least 1.2 meters tall
  • Store electrical components at least 3 meters from the pool’s edge
  • Schedule a compliance review with the city after installation

Step-by-Step Installation Process

Location Evaluation and Yard Preparation

Before any structure assembly, a professional site assessment ensures your property is ready. Laser-guided grading removes unevenness to prevent structural stress. This phase includes checking drainage, all critical for long-term stability. Skipping this step risks costly repairs down the line.

  • Designate a level area away from roots
  • Excavate sod, rocks, and underground hazards
  • Use sand or padding for a uniform foundation
  • Verify level with a professional gauge

Above-Ground Pool Cost in Alberta

Average Price Range by Pool Type

Opting for an above-ground pool typically costs between $3,000 and $8,000 in Southwest Calgary, while permanent vs seasonal setups can push prices from $15,000 to over $40,000. The affordable pool installation appeal of easy set up pools makes them a popular for many homeowners.

Local pool suppliers often bundle above-ground pool accessories into base quotes, influencing the final total investment.

  • Entry-level above-ground models start around $3,000–$5,000 set up
  • Semi-custom backyard pool designs range from $6,000–$9,500
  • Upgrades like pool cover installation add $500–$2,000

Smart Care Strategies for Pool Owners in Calgary

Keeping Your Pool Water Safe and Sparkling

Keeping up with basic pool care is key to preventing algae, bacteria, and cloudy water. Use a skimmer to remove debris and test pH and chlorine levels 2–3 times a week with water testing kits. Adjusting alkalinity, reference pH, and sanitizer keeps your pool filter systems running smoothly.

  • Check chemistry every 3–4 days during peak swimming months
  • Rinse skimmer and pump baskets regularly
  • Sanitize the pool every two weeks

How to Prepare Your Pool for Calgary’s Cold Season

Because of harsh Alberta winters, proper seasonal shutdown is non-negotiable. Drain water to the correct level, remove pumps, blow out plumbing lines, and secure a air pillow to prevent snow and ice damage. Skipping this step risks liner tears come spring.

Arrange for your winterizing process by late October—don’t wait for the first snow. Many local installers offer year-round pool maintenance to guarantee a smooth reopening.

Smart Habits to Avoid Costly Replacements

Protecting your pump unit saves hundreds in emergency repairs. Keep chlorine levels stable to reduce liner fading and cracking, and run the pump 8–12 hours daily for effective circulation. Clean the pump monthly and replace filters as recommended.

  • Add a solar cover to reduce UV exposure and chemical loss
  • Prevent sharp objects, toys, and pets from contacting the floor
  • Schedule annual checkups with a trusted installer for preventive maintenance
